well I'll throw my 2 cents in here having had stock, prochamber, mac h, and now an xpipe.
Stock we all know what it sounds like and how it pulls.
Prochamber - lil throaty nice sound not real loud. strong from idle-5500 nice and smooth. WILL not clear a DS loop and allow tech to see it. UGHHH
Mac OR hpipe - sound makes me drool however mine would never stay sealed and exhaust leak free for more than a few days at a time. UGHHH pulled from 2k-5900 was nice felt a lil less torquey down low had to use the gears more.

Xpipe - sound is well an xpipe raspy kinda nascarish to me. kinda weird on the rpm badn though. Pulls good from idle to 2k or so then goes kinda flat till over 4k then rips to redline. So I've found I either have to use the shifter more to either get down into the low rpms for city driving or let her rip to pass on the interstates. very weird IMO. But it is leak free, and clears DS loop.
